DG Health Cough DM 30 mg/5mL
dextromethorphan polistirex · SUSPENSION · Dolgencorp, LLC
Dg Health Cough DM is an over-the-counter cough suppressant suspension containing dextromethorphan that you take by mouth to help relieve coughs. This medication is commonly used to temporarily reduce coughing due to colds or other minor respiratory irritations.

What is DG Health Cough DM used for?
Dg Health Cough DM is an over-the-counter cough suppressant suspension containing dextromethorphan that you take by mouth to help relieve coughs. This medication is commonly used to temporarily reduce coughing due to colds or other minor respiratory irritations.
Is DG Health Cough DM a controlled substance?
DG Health Cough DM is not classified as a controlled substance by the DEA.
